Biking in Comfort: A Deep Dive into Bicycle Pants with Padding

Bicycle pants with padding, also known as cycling shorts or padded bike shorts, are form-fitting, knee-length pants specifically designed for cycling. These pants feature a cushioned lining, typically made of foam or gel, that provides extra comfort and support to the rider’s backside, reducing pressure and friction during long rides.

The relevance of bicycle pants with padding cannot be overstated. Cycling is a popular form of exercise and recreation, and padded bike shorts enhance the overall riding experience. The padding helps prevent saddle sores, chafing, and numbness, allowing cyclists to ride longer and more comfortably. A significant historical development in the evolution of bicycle pants with padding was the introduction of synthetic materials, which improved breathability, moisture-wicking properties, and overall comfort.

Cushioning

In the realm of cycling apparel, bicycle pants with padding, also known as cycling shorts or padded bike shorts, stand out as essential gear for enhancing comfort and performance during rides. At the heart of these specialized pants lies the cushioning, typically made of foam or gel, which plays a pivotal role in mitigating discomfort and supporting cyclists throughout their journeys.

The connection between cushioning and bicycle pants padded is one of cause and effect. The presence of cushioning directly impacts the comfort level experienced by the cyclist. When riding a bicycle, the rider’s weight rests on the saddle, putting pressure on sensitive areas. Without adequate cushioning, this pressure can lead to saddle sores, chafing, and numbness, detracting from the overall cycling experience and potentially causing pain and discomfort.

Cushioning in bicycle pants padded serves as a crucial component in addressing these issues. The foam or gel padding absorbs shock and distributes pressure evenly, reducing the impact on the rider’s backside. This cushioning effect minimizes friction and irritation, preventing the development of saddle sores and chafing. Additionally, the padding provides support to the rider’s, the two bony prominences on the underside of the pelvis, which bear most of the weight while cycling.

Real-life examples abound, showcasing the practical applications and benefits of cushioning in bicycle pants padded. Cyclists who embark on long rides, participate in races, or engage in intensive training sessions often rely on padded bike shorts to ensure comfort and prevent discomfort. The cushioning allows them to focus on their performance and enjoy the ride without being distracted by pain or irritation.

Materials

In the realm of bicycle pants padded, the choice of materials plays a pivotal role in ensuring comfort and performance during cycling activities. Among the various materials used, synthetic fabrics stand out for their exceptional breathability and moisture-wicking properties, contributing significantly to the overall effectiveness of padded bike shorts.

  • Quick-drying: Synthetic fabrics, such as polyester and nylon, are known for their rapid drying time, allowing sweat to evaporate quickly and keeping the cyclist cool and dry.
  • Breathable: The structure of synthetic fabrics facilitates airflow, allowing heat and moisture to escape, preventing overheating and maintaining a comfortable body temperature.
  • Wicking: Synthetic fabrics possess the ability to draw sweat away from the skin and spread it over a larger surface area, where it can evaporate more efficiently.
  • Antimicrobial: Some synthetic fabrics are treated with antimicrobial agents to inhibit the growth of odor-causing bacteria, ensuring freshness and hygiene even during extended rides.

The combination of these properties makes synthetic fabrics ideally suited for bicycle pants padded. By keeping the cyclist cool, dry, and comfortable, these materials enhance the overall cycling experience, allowing riders to focus on their performance and enjoy their rides to the fullest. Additionally, the quick-drying nature of synthetic fabrics makes them easy to care for and maintain, contributing to their longevity and durability.

Seams

In the realm of bicycle pants padded, the significance of seams cannot be overstated. Flatlock or seamless construction stands as a critical component, directly influencing the comfort and performance of cyclists during their rides. This connection between seams and padded bike shorts is multifaceted, encompassing cause and effect, practical applications, and broader implications.

Cause and Effect: The presence of flatlock or seamless seams in bicycle pants padded directly impacts the rider’s comfort level. Traditional seams, often found in lower-quality cycling shorts, can cause irritation and chafing due to friction against the skin, especially during long rides. Flatlock seams, on the other hand, lie flat against the skin, reducing friction and minimizing the risk of chafing. Seamless construction takes this a step further, eliminating seams altogether, providing the ultimate in comfort and reducing the potential for irritation.

Critical Component: Flatlock or seamless construction is a critical component of bicycle pants padded due to its role in preventing chafing. Chafing is a common issue among cyclists, causing discomfort, pain, and even skin damage. By eliminating or minimizing seams, padded bike shorts with flatlock or seamless construction effectively address this problem, allowing cyclists to focus on their rides without the distraction of irritation.

Frequently Asked Questions

This FAQ section addresses common queries and provides clarity on various aspects of bicycle pants padded, aiming to inform and assist readers in making informed choices.

Question 1: What are the primary benefits of bicycle pants padded?

Answer: Bicycle pants padded offer several benefits, including enhanced comfort during long rides, reduced risk of saddle sores and chafing, improved muscle support, and enhanced performance through increased blood flow and reduced fatigue.

Question 2: How do I choose the right padding density for my cycling needs?

Answer: The appropriate padding density depends on your riding style and personal preferences. Higher density padding provides more cushioning for long rides and rough terrain, while lower density padding offers breathability and flexibility for shorter rides and warmer climates.

Question 3: What are the key features to look for when purchasing bicycle pants padded?

Answer: Consider factors such as fit, breathability, moisture-wicking capabilities, seam construction, pocket options, reflective elements, and padding density. Choose pants that align with your riding style and provide the desired level of comfort and support.

Question 4: How do I properly care for and maintain bicycle pants padded?

Answer: To ensure longevity and optimal performance, follow the care instructions provided on the garment’s label. Generally, hand washing or gentle machine washing in cold water with a mild detergent is recommended. Avoid using fabric softeners, bleach, or harsh detergents, and air dry the pants to prevent damage.

Question 5: Are bicycle pants padded suitable for all types of cycling?

Answer: While bicycle pants padded are commonly used for road cycling, they can also be suitable for other cycling disciplines, such as mountain biking, touring, and commuting. However, specific activities or terrains may require specialized pants designed for those purposes.

Question 6: How do bicycle pants padded compare to traditional cycling shorts?

Answer: Bicycle pants padded offer several advantages over traditional cycling shorts, including enhanced cushioning, improved moisture management, better breathability, and additional features such as pockets and reflective elements. These features combine to provide increased comfort, performance, and safety for cyclists.

Tips for Choosing and Using Bicycle Pants Padded

This section provides valuable tips to help cyclists select and utilize bicycle pants padded effectively, ensuring a comfortable and enhanced riding experience.

Tip 1: Consider Your Riding Style and Needs: Carefully assess your riding style, whether it involves long-distance rides, rough terrain, or competitive racing. Choose pants with appropriate padding density and features that align with your specific needs.

Tip 2: Prioritize Fit and Comfort: Ensure a snug yet comfortable fit to maximize the benefits of padding. Avoid pants that are too tight or too loose, as they can cause discomfort and affect performance.

Tip 3: Choose Breathable and Moisture-Wicking Materials: Opt for pants made from breathable fabrics that wick away sweat, keeping you cool and dry during intense rides. Synthetic materials like polyester and nylon are commonly used for their excellent moisture management properties.

Tip 4: Pay Attention to Seam Construction: Look for pants with flatlock or seamless seams to minimize chafing and irritation, especially during long rides. Seamless construction provides the ultimate comfort by eliminating seams altogether.

Tip 5: Consider Pockets and Reflective Elements: Choose pants with strategically placed pockets for convenient storage of essentials like keys, energy gels, and small tools. Reflective elements enhance visibility in low-light conditions, increasing safety during early morning or evening rides.

Tip 6: Follow Proper Care Instructions: To maintain the performance and longevity of your bicycle pants padded, follow the care instructions provided on the garment’s label. Generally, hand washing or gentle machine washing in cold water with a mild detergent is recommended.

Tip 7: Layer Up for Cold Weather: In colder climates or during winter rides, consider layering tights or leggings underneath your padded pants for added warmth and protection against the elements.

Tip 8: Experiment and Find Your Perfect Pair: With various brands and models available, try different bicycle pants padded to find the ones that best suit your body type, riding style, and personal preferences.
